  • Patent number: 7557669
    Abstract: An object of the present invention is to provide a voltage controlled oscillator in a microwave band without narrowing the variable frequency range and having improved phase noise characteristics. This invention is a voltage controlled oscillator in the microwave band which controls an oscillation frequency by a varactor diode, a varactor diode circuit in which a plurality of series-connected circuits having the varactor diode and a capacitance connected in series are connected in parallel and the varactor diodes include at least one or more GaAs varactor diodes of the HyperAbrupt type and at least one or more Si varactor diodes of the Abrupt type.

  • Publication number: 20080086029
    Abstract: A rotary self-propelled endoscope system includes an insertion section body, an insertion section, a drive unit, a torque detection unit, and a control unit. In a distal end portion of the insertion section body, a rigid distal end portion including an image pickup apparatus is disposed. The insertion section is rotatably fit to the outside of the insertion section body, and includes a rotary tubular member having a helical portion formed by a helical concave-convex portion. The drive unit applies the rotary tubular member with axial and rotational drive force. The torque detection unit detects torque information of the rotary tubular member. On the basis of the torque information detected by the torque detection unit, the control unit compares a present value with a preset limit value for controlling the torque of the rotary tubular member, and controls the drive unit on the basis of the comparison result.

  • Patent number: 5994212
    Abstract: A semiconductor chip is bonded onto a die pad portion of a lead frame including nickel/palladium/gold stacked plate layers. Then, a first bonding procedure is carried out with a metal wire of gold pressed against an electrode pad of the semiconductor chip while applying a load of approximately 60 g and ultrasonic waves with a power of approximately 55 mW by using a bonding tool. Subsequently, a second bonding procedure is carried out with the metal wire pressed against an inner lead portion of the lead frame while applying a load of 150 through 250 g and the ultrasonic waves with a power of 0 through 20 mW. In the second bonding procedure, the wire bonding in conformity with the property of the stacked plate layers can be conducted using a large load and a small ultrasonic power, resulting in attaining firm bonding in a short period of time without causing peeling of the gold plate layer.

  • Patent number: 5935468
    Abstract: The present invention relates to an insulated electrically heated pot which is provided with an insulated container and an electric heating apparatus disposed therewithin, into which insulated container a liquid such as water or the like is introduced and heated, and the temperature thereof is maintained, as well as to a manufacturing method therefor. In the insulated electrically heated pot in accordance with the present invention, at least one gas having a low conductivity selected from the group consisting of xenon, krypton, and argon is made to fill the insulating layer of the insulated container.
